PURPOSE OF JOB CLASS (NATURE OF WORK)

In state facilities this class is accountable for providing clinical dental hygiene services, including dental health assessments of individuals, training of individuals and staff in the implementation of dental health care plans, and providing consultation.

EXAMPLES OF DUTIES

Performs clinical dental services including dental prophylaxis, facial and oral tissue exams, oral cancer exams, topical fluoride treatments, blood pressure evaluations, taking and processing radiographs, charting abnormalities, screening individuals for systemic diseases which may appear in the oral cavity; conducts dental health assessments; develops and implements dental hygiene care plans; provides admission and discharge dental hygiene assessments including plans for continuing care; does nutritional counseling; reviews diets and nutritional needs of individuals; provides functional supervision of staff members involved in dental care of individuals, which includes creation of an awareness among staff of signs and symptoms of dental diseases and procedures for prevention of same, showing ward staff how to maintain oral health of individuals who cannot care for themselves, and providing centralized inservice dental education and training to individuals and staff; implements dental care programs, and sets goals to meet needs of each individual; consults with and makes recommendations to dentist concerning dental health needs; investigates problems arising from dental care programs as relayed by staff or departments; maintains dental records and recall system to assure individuals treated regularly; assures dental care services comply with ICF regulations; provides dental hygiene input into interdisciplinary health care plans and individual programs; performs related duties as required.

KNOWLEDGE, SKILL AND ABILITY

Considerable knowledge of principles and practices of dental hygiene, dental hygiene administration and dynamics of behavior, particularly the behavior of difficult and multi-handicapped individuals; considerable interpersonal skills; oral and written communication skills.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S - GENERAL EXPERIENCE

Two (2) years of experience as a dental hygienist in a state facility or in practice with difficult or multi-handicapped individuals.

S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S

1. Incumbents in this class must possess and retain a license as a Registered Dental Hygienist in Connecticut.
2. Incumbents in this class may be required to travel.

WORKING CONDITIONS

Incumbents in this class may be required to lift and restrain individuals and may be exposed to disagreeable conditions, communicable diseases and risk of injury from assaultive and/or abusive individuals.
